AJ Styles didn’t retire as many thought. He tricked Cody Rhodes into thinking he was leaving wrestling, only to attack him with a Styles Clash. In response, Cody challenged AJ to an “I Quit” match for the Undisputed WWE Title at Clash at the Castle: Scotland.

Neither wrestler has competed in an “I Quit” match before, adding extra intrigue to their upcoming bout. The last time these two faced off was at Backlash: France, where Cody emerged victorious in a memorable match. Since then, Cody has successfully defended his title against Logan Paul at King and Queen of the Ring.

On the other hand, AJ lost to Randy Orton in the King of the Ring Tournament but has quickly bounced back into title contention. The upcoming match promises to be personal and brutal, with the question of who will be forced to utter the words “I Quit.”
